Revised Test schedule.

Dec. 17. First Test. Adelaide.

Day/nighter. Starts 3 pm.

--------------------

Dec. 26. Boxing Day Test. MCG.

Starts 10.30

------------------

Jan. 7. Third Test. SCG.

Starts 10.30

---------------------

Jan. 15. Fourth Test. Gabba.

Starts 10 am. Local.

Australia A v India A, December 6-8, Drummoyne Oval

Australia A v Indians, December 11-13, SCG (day-night)

Australia A squad: Sean Abbott, Ashton Agar, Joe Burns, Jackson Bird, Alex Carey (wk), Harry Conway, Cameron Green, Marcus Harris, Travis Head, Moises Henriques, Nic Maddinson, Mitchell Marsh (subject to fitness), Michael Neser, Tim Paine, James Pattinson, Will Pucovski, Mark Steketee, Will Sutherland, Mitchell Swepson

India Test squad: Virat Kohli (c)*, Ajinkya Rahane (vice-captain), Rohit Sharma, Mayank Agarwal*, Prithvi Shaw, KL Rahul*, Cheteshwar Pujara, Hanuma Vihari, Shubman Gill, Wriddhiman Saha (wk), Rishabh Pant (wk), Jasprit Bumrah*, Mohammed Shami*, Umesh Yadav, Navdeep Saini*, Kuldeep Yadav, Ravindra Jadeja*, Ravichandran Ashwin, Mohammed Siraj

* Unavailable for first tour game
